Kenya’s Energy and Petroleum Regulatory Authority (EPRA) recently approved new electricity tariffs effective April 1st. As part of this latest tariff review, EPRA introduced a special tariff regime for the electric mobility sector. Metrotrans Ltd, one of Nairobi’s leading public transport operators, has announced the introduction of 5 electric buses as part of its fleet. Metrotrans is a Nairobi-based Savings and Credit Cooperative Society (Sacco), whose fleet plies Nairobi routes with an aim to promote efficient and sustainable public transportation systems. Roam RapidKenya and the European Commission have reached an agreement for a €347.6 million financing arrangement for East Africa’s first dedicated electric bus rapid lane. The agreement was signed during a meeting between President William Ruto and the President of the European Commission, Ursula von der Leyen, at the European Commission Headquarters in Brussels, Belgium. Equator Energy is a fully integrated solar power provider headquarted in Nairobi, Kenya. Equator Energy also has a presence in Uganda, as well as regional staff in South Sudan, Somalia, and Zimbabwe.
